What is Very Important People about?

Very Important People takes the simple pleasure of watching someone get a complete makeover and pairs it with the unpredictable chaos of live comedy. Hosted by comedian Vic Michaelis, the show puts professional funnypeople through elaborate transformations—new wigs, costumes, personas, the works—and then throws them directly into a fully improvised interview with no script, no safety net, and no way to rely on their usual material. It's a high-wire act of comedy where the real payoff isn't the makeover itself, but what happens when comedians are forced to interact as entirely different characters. The premise taps into something genuinely entertaining: comedians are usually in control of their craft, and watching them scramble to be funny while pretending to be someone else entirely creates an immediate, infectious energy.

The show's tone sits somewhere between improv challenge and character comedy, with Michaelis serving as both ringmaster and straight man to whatever bizarre chemistry emerges. What makes Very Important People distinctive is its willingness to let scenes breathe and fail organically rather than relying on post-production tricks or heavy editing to manufacture humor. The commitment required from participants—maintaining a character while staying quick on their feet—means the best moments feel genuinely earned. The tagline promises permission to shed your identity, and the show follows through on that promise with a lightness that feels distinctly at home on Dropout, where comedy often skews more experimental and collaborative.

The show has found a solid audience since its December 2023 debut, accumulating a respectable 8.1 IMDb rating across nearly 330 votes. That score speaks to a fanbase that appreciates both the improvisational craft on display and the sheer absurdity of watching good comedians work without a net. Three seasons and 45 episodes in, Very Important People has established itself as reliable comedy content that delivers on its central conceit while letting host and guests bounce off each other with genuine spontaneity.

As a piece of comedy programming, the show occupies a distinctly online space—it's the kind of format that thrives on a platform like Dropout because it celebrates comedians as skilled improvisers rather than as vehicles for polished punchlines. It joins a growing tradition of comedy that prioritizes the live, the chaotic, and the collaborative, proving that some of the most entertaining comedy comes not from a writer's room but from talented people put in uncomfortable situations and asked to be funny anyway.

Very Important People Season 4 Release Date

Without a confirmed renewal, predicting a release window is speculative. If the show follows its established cadence — roughly one season per year — and if a renewal were greenlit in mid-2026, a Season 4 could plausibly arrive in late 2026 or early 2027. However, Vic Michaelis's concurrent work on Ponies may push production later, making a 2027 debut the more realistic scenario if the show is indeed renewed. Dropout originals typically have modest production footprints that allow for faster turnarounds than traditional network shows, so a compressed timeline is not out of the question if schedules align.
